Since the position of University vice chancellors were politicized and their salaries escalated from that of normal professors who earn about 500k monthly to about N4m with so many perks including police escorts and siren they started attracting the attention of kidnappers, both they and their immediate members of their families. Yes kidnapping is bad and we all condemn it but this action of the vice chancellors in securing a unique package for themselves is equally as bad. Imagine a VC going from his official residential quarters to the vice chancellor office using police escort and siren almost running us university staff from the road - that is how low things have got. In the past a VC was not so different from the normal lecturer, in fact during my MBA program the VC then left his office matters to lecture us in a particular course as he was bored and tired of the administrative monotony. He drove himself to the classroom in his old 504 then, now this one is using Jeep plus escort to oppress everybody. Let them negotiate to N40m and pay up fast before the poor man would die there. 4 Likes |
